Web warriors

    Students at Dallastown Area High School in York, Pa., have mastered the art of cyberwarfare, winning a regional round of a cyber security competition organized by the Air Force Association.

    The Dallastown team is composed of members of the school’s Marine Corps Junior ROTC, and they will face off against other youth cyber defense teams.

    The competition challenges students to find ways to ward off mock cyber attacks. The team must correctly install antiviral and malware protection, check for vulnerable outside access points and perform other Internet security jobs within a certain time period. The team moves on to the next phase of the competition next month.
